What Is the A/C 20 Degree Rule?

The a/c 20 degree rule is a guideline for setting your air conditioner’s temperature. It suggests keeping the indoor temperature no more than 20 degrees cooler than the outside. This simple practice helps balance comfort with energy efficiency. As an ac temperature rule, it supports energy saving ac goals.

When outdoor temperatures soar, it’s tempting to crank the AC. However, following this rule can prevent your system from overexerting itself. Overworking an air conditioner can lead to higher energy bills and increased wear and tear.

Consider this: if it’s 90°F outside, aim to set your AC no lower than 70°F. Such a setting not only maintains comfort but also keeps energy use in check.

Common Myths and Misconceptions About AC Temperature Rules

Many people believe setting the thermostat extremely low cools the house faster. However, this is a misconception. The AC unit cools at a consistent rate, regardless of the set temperature.

Another myth is that leaving the AC on all day saves energy. In reality, it wastes energy and racks up costs. It’s more efficient to set the thermostat higher when you’re away and lower only when you’re home. Use the ac temperature rule as your guide instead.

Additionally, some think ceiling fans cool rooms. Fans only circulate air, making you feel cooler, not changing room temperature. Here are some common myths debunked:

Why You Cannot Ignore Regular AC Care

Let’s talk about the bottom line first. One of the most immediate and appealing perks of routine care is reducing monthly energy bills with HVAC maintenance. When your cooling system is clogged with dust or struggling due to worn-out mechanical parts, it has to work twice as hard to produce the exact same amount of cool air. This extra effort directly inflates your utility costs, causing your summer electricity bills to skyrocket.

By contrast, the energy efficiency benefits of regular AC cleaning are substantial and immediate. Clearing away accumulated dust, dirt, and debris allows the system’s internal mechanisms to operate smoothly. In many cases, this mechanical optimization leads to measurable improvements in the SEER rating through maintenance. The Seasonal Energy Efficiency Ratio (SEER) measures your unit’s overall efficiency, and keeping it finely tuned means you get maximum cooling power for every dollar spent.

Furthermore, regular check-ups significantly extend the lifespan of the central air conditioning system. Replacing an entire household cooling system is a major financial burden that most homeowners want to delay as long as possible. Keeping your current unit running efficiently for 15 to 20 years is a massive win and entirely achievable with consistent, professional care.

Timing is Everything: When and How to Service Your Unit

Homeowners frequently ask, “How often should an air conditioner be serviced?” The industry golden rule is at least once a year, ideally in the mid-to-late spring. This timing perfectly aligns with how to prepare your cooling system for summer, ensuring your unit is clean, lubricated, and fully primed before the first major heatwave hits. It’s also the best window to schedule HVAC service without peak-season delays.

While some homeowners love a good weekend DIY project, it’s crucial to understand the distinct boundaries of a professional AC tune-up vs DIY maintenance. You can—and absolutely should—change your own air filters, wipe down vents, and clear yard debris from around the outdoor condenser unit. However, testing intricate electrical connections, measuring blower motor voltage, and handling potentially hazardous chemical refrigerants require specialized training and equipment from a licensed HVAC service provider. Trusting a professional ensures safety, prevents accidental damage, and protects your manufacturer’s warranty.

Common Warning Signs: Catching Problems Before They Escalate

Even with the best intentions, mechanical wear and tear happen. One of the most frustrating experiences for any homeowner is turning on the thermostat only to feel hot, sticky air coming from the vents. Common reasons for an air conditioner blowing warm air include a tripped circuit breaker, a frozen evaporator coil, or a severe lack of refrigerant fluid.

If you notice a sudden drop in your system’s cooling power, hear strange hissing noises coming from the unit, or see ice building up on the refrigerant lines, these are classic signs your AC unit needs a recharge. However, it is vital to note that simply adding more refrigerant isn’t a permanent solution. Because AC units operate on a closed loop, low refrigerant levels indicate a leak somewhere in the system. A professional technician will perform thorough refrigerant leak detection and repair to fix the underlying structural issue and prevent the expensive gas from escaping again.

Ignoring these early warning signs can lead to total, catastrophic system failure. By staying proactive with routine HVAC maintenance, you can avoid the exorbitant emergency air conditioning repair costs that often arise when units break down during busy holiday weekends or late-night heatwaves.

The Ultimate Preventive Care Checklist

To keep your system running beautifully all summer long, here is a highly practical preventative AC maintenance checklist for homeowners to follow. These steps are designed to perfectly complement your annual professional tune-up:

  1. Swap the Air Filter Regularly: Start by improving indoor air quality by replacing the filter. A clogged air filter restricts vital airflow, forcing the entire system to overwork while simultaneously circulating dust, pet dander, and allergens throughout your living spaces. Replace your filter every 30 to 90 days, depending on your household’s unique needs.
  2. Inspect and Clean the Coils: During a professional visit, your technician will utilize specialized HVAC evaporator coil cleaning techniques to remove deep-seated grime. Dirt acts as an unwanted insulator, preventing the coil from absorbing heat effectively and drastically reducing your unit’s cooling capacity.
  3. Optimize the Controls: Always ask your technician to calibrate the thermostat for peak performance. If your thermostat is reading the room temperature incorrectly, your AC will either short-cycle or run constantly. Proper calibration ensures the system cycles on and off at the exact right moments, saving energy and reducing mechanical strain.
  4. Clear the Condenser Perimeter: Keep the area immediately surrounding your outdoor unit completely free of fallen leaves, twigs, grass clippings, and overgrown shrubs. Aim for at least two feet of clear space in every direction to guarantee proper, unobstructed airflow.
  5. Check the Condensate Drain: The drain line removes condensation produced by your AC’s evaporator coil. If this line clogs with algae or dirt, water can back up and cause expensive water damage to your home. A professional will flush this line as part of routine air conditioning maintenance to keep the system running safely.
